A recall published by DVSA, the British vehicle safety authority, with every version of its wording that this site has read. Unchanged since first read.

DVSA referenceRM/2006/008
Launched11 April 2006
MakeSuzuki (listed as SUZUKI GB PLC)
Manufacturer referencenot stated
Vehicles listed392

Models

ModelVehiclesBuilt fromBuilt to
VL15003921 January 199831 December 1999

Concern

Fuel may leak from fuel tank

Defect, as DVSA words it

It has been identified due to the method used to mount the fuel tank that under certain engine conditions it is possible for a hairline crack to develop in the fuel tank. This can result in the fuel tank leaking.

Remedy, as DVSA words it

Recalled machines will have the fuel tank removed and visually inspected for cracks following which the tank will be subject to pressure testing. If the tank should be found to leak it will be replaced. In any event all affected machines will be fitted with a re-designed fuel tank mounting kit to prevent future problems.
